Looking for Pictures of YOUR stainless 2.5" exhaust systems

FWIW....looking at an old ATR catalog.... They show 2 types of 2.5" SS exhausts.

One uses offset in/out aluminzed super turbo mufflers (that's the system I have).

The other one uses center in/out SS mufflers (probably the system Turbodave has).

It appears the Y pipe to the mufflers are bent different to accomodate the different style mufflers.

There were 2 versions of the ATR tailpipes...I have then both...the exhaust on my GN I got from ATR around 1993...tailpipes have a bracket welded near the end of the pipe and bolts to the frame...the ATR exhaust on my "T" I got around 2004...tailpipes have a bracket welded up near the curve over the axle and they use the stock hangers...I ordered both sets with the alum pitbulls and they are center inlet/outlet...
